English Translation
Aisha, Ummul Mu'minin (may Allah be pleased with her) reported that i said to the Prophet ﷺ: It is enough for you in Safiyyah that she is such and such (the other version than Musaddad's has:) meaning that she was short-statured. He replied; You have said a word which would change the sea if it were mixed in it. She said: I imitated a man before him (out of disgrace). He said: I do not like that I imitate anyone even if I should get such and such
